  • Bletchley ParkOpens in a new window – Uncover the secrets of Bletchley Park, a historic site that played a pivotal role during World War II. Explore the fascinating stories behind codebreaking and espionage while walking through the charming grounds. The combination of history and beautiful gardens creates a unique experience that transports you back in time.

Best time to go to London (LTN-Luton)

London (LTN-Luton) exper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 38.8°F (3.8°C), while July is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 62.8°F (17.1°C). October are usually the wettest months. February, July, and September are the peak travel months at London (LTN-Luton), attracting a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ny to mostly cloudy, accompanied by no to light rainfall. On the other hand, October to December tend to be quieter times to visit, marked by light rainfall and mostly cloudy conditions.

Where is Luton Airport (LTN)?

The airport is located 1.6 mi (2.7 km) from Luton city center. If you'd like to find things to see and do in the area, you might like to visit Warner Bros. Studio Tour London and Luton Mall.
